Dec 19, 2019 • 24min
Precinct closures, voting issues in Georgia
AJC reporter Mark Niesse joined the podcast to discuss the reporting and analysis he and AJC data reporter Nick Thieme did that found that precinct closers harmed voter turnout in Georgia. The closures accelerated after Supreme Court invalidated the Voting Rights Act provision, which put thousands farther from the polls. Learn more about your ad choices. Visit megaphone.fm/adchoices

Nov 11, 2019 • 12min
Trump visited Atlanta to court black voters. Here’s what happened.
Last Friday, President Donald Trump visited Atlanta to launch a new black voter initiative and fundraise for Sen. David Perdue. Politically Georgia producer Bria Felicien shares the story of what happened that day, from the Georgia Democrats’ morning press conference to the launch of “Black Voices for Trump.” This episode also includes her interviews with black Trump supporters and protesters.
